The stress that causes strike-slip faults is produced by a shearing force and so is called shear stress.
A lateral fault is when Shearing causes rock blocks to slide horizontally past each other.

Shearing causes a type of movement called sliding or shifting. It occurs when forces are applied to an object in opposite directions but parallel to each other. This causes the object to move or deform along a plane or surface.
